What do you post on your Facebook Page??

l'm stuck, I created a Facebook page a while back ago for my shop in hopes to gain some more followers but lately I've been stuck as to what I should post and I need ideas and suggestions.

I've been trying not to post only items from my shop and I'd like to include other shops and what you guys are doing, excited about and what not. But I am unsure of how to go about doing it. I just love when I see other shops featuring other shops in their blog, or Facebook page.

Any ideas are very welcome!

I post my items with a little chit chat. I list 8 items a day but only post 3 to FB.

I also post sneak peek photo albums once a week. That way Facebook fans get first dibs.

I occasionally post likes to my favorite schools, museums, pet shelters and the like. I try to keep these postings noncontroversial.

I post links to shows I will be attending as a vendor

I post a lot of different things. I get the most views from photos, though, so I post and repost those in different contexts often. For example, I post a photo with a link in the caption when I first list the item, and repost it when I renew the item, then repost it again in another album if it applies to the latest holiday. For example, I have an album of Mother's Day gift ideas with photos of and links to my products that would be good for Mother's Day, most of which are also posted in other albums on my page.

I also post questions, but don't usually get any response to them. Just trying to engage my fans but for some reason I just don't get any response.
I post events, sales, coupons, links to other shops I admire, a little blurb when I'm producing a new product line, tips for upcoming holidays, that sort of stuff. You can check it out, links are all over my shop.
